Giant Ferris Wheel coming to Moreton Bay

By Tyler Nash

Skyline Attractions will soon begin installing a 35m Ferris Wheel at Woody Point, which will operate for the next five months.

Known for owning and operating three giant Ferris Wheels across Australia including in Melbourne, Glenelg, Sunshine Coast and Darwin, Skyline Attractions is excited to bring this attraction to the Moreton Bay region.
